You have to cut the front struts open and insert the cartridge and bolt it from the bottom of the strut housing. Its not that hard to do if you have the right tools. The rears shocks are just a remove and replace job. I did mine by myself taking my time and it took 8 hours, but I used a hacksaw with fresh blades to cut the front strut cuz I didnt want to spend 25 bucks on a pipe cutter.
About the ride. At the softest setting its just a small amount firmer then stock, but your cornering speed and control will increase. It was awesome the first time I took an off ramp and my car was basically flat in the turn. Make it firmer and the ride gets harsher, but you'll corner like a real sports car heh.
